## Authentication

The Tallowgate audit-log viewer authenticates against the internal Pinchbeck credential service, not the general SSO tier, because audit records are classified as restricted. Every request must carry a signed service token plus the viewer's internal key; tokens expire after fifteen minutes and are never cached to disk. Revocation is checked on each read, so a disabled account loses access immediately. For local review builds, configure the client with the key that follows.

service key, tadup-tahog: zpat7_wB1tnEL

TURN-208: Gatevale turnstile counters at the Merrow Field pilot double-count when a rotation reverses mid-cycle. Attendance totals drift roughly 2% high per event. The debounce window fix is implemented, reviewed by Ilsa, and soak-tested across two simulated match days without drift. Ready for your cut; the candidate build is identified below.

trace token, tagag-tafog: htk6_5ed18c

**14:22** — The Larkspell extraction script was re-run under a locked service account after we confirmed it had silently skipped escaped placeholders, producing incomplete catalogs for the Maravon locale pack. Output hashes were compared against the pre-incident baseline and archived for audit. The verifying build's token is recorded below.

pipeline stamp: htk31_f769b577b3028a4e9958e5bb8d1259a

14:32 — The donation-receipt mailer for Givewell Garden (our nonprofit tier) began sending duplicate receipts. Root cause was a retry loop in the Postfern queue worker that didn't mark messages as delivered. On-call paused the queue at 14:41, drained duplicates, and resumed at 15:05. Roughly 2,100 donors were affected. For anyone auditing this later, the trace token from the affected deploy appears below.

session token of yajof-bagef = htk4_937d

The Pingwell reminder job fires every morning at six and sweeps the Larkfield Clinic schedule for appointments in the next 48 hours. Your plugin can hook into the pre-send phase to tweak message templates or suppress reminders entirely. Just register a callback with the scheduler endpoint. To call that endpoint from your plugin, authenticate with the key below.

API key for tagef-fafop: vxb2-ta